Your Brain and Body on Ketones with Dr. Dom D'Agostino
Dr. Dom D’Agostino is a research scientist and Associate Professor of Molecular Pharmacology and Physiology at the University of South Florida Morsani College of Medicine. He owns KETONUTRITION, a platform where he shares his recent findings regarding our health and nutritional intake, with a special focus on the ketogenic diet. Dom teaches students at USF on topics such as neuropharmacology, medical biochemistry, and neuroscience. He is often asked to participate in experiments conducted by NASA and the U.S. military.
Dom joins us today to discuss how ketosis was used as clinical treatment, how it is used today, and how ketosis affects our brain. He shares where he found his passion for neuroscience and when he took part in a project by NASA. He describes how exogenous ketones work and how keto enthusiasts can use them. Dom also explains what cancer is, from a metabolic and genetic viewpoint, and why mitochondrial health can determine cancer risk.
“The ketogenic diet reduces the production of reactive oxygen species overall.” - Dr. Dom D’Agostino
